USS Nashville (CL 43)
Light cruiser of the Brooklyn class

Chilian cruiser Capitan Prat former USS Nashville.
| Navy | The US Navy |
| Type | Light cruiser |
| Class | Brooklyn |
| Pennant | CL 43 |
| Built by | New York Shipbuilding Corp. (Camden, New Jersey, U.S.A.) |
| Ordered | |
| Laid down | 24 Jan 1935 |
| Launched | 2 Oct 1937 |
| Commissioned | 6 Jun 1938 |
| End service | 24 Jun 1946 |
| Loss position | |
| History | Decommissioned 24 June 1946. |
